What are the most common Ford repair issues you see in Andover, Iowa, due to our local driving conditions?

Given Andover's rural roads and harsh winter weather, we frequently service Ford trucks and SUVs for suspension components worn by rough terrain and for issues related to the 4WD system. Cold starts also commonly lead to battery and alternator problems on many Ford models, especially older ones.

When should I seek service for my Ford's check engine light around Andover?

You should seek diagnostics immediately if the light is flashing, indicating a severe misfire that could damage the catalytic converter. For a steady light, schedule service promptly, as it could be related to emissions or sensor issues that affect fuel efficiency, important for longer drives to Davenport or the Quad Cities.

What local considerations should I keep in mind for seasonal Ford maintenance in Andover?

Before winter, have your Ford's battery, tire tread (consider all-terrain or snow tires for our county roads), and heating system thoroughly checked. Before the hot, humid summer, ensure your cooling system, air conditioning, and radiator are serviced to prevent overheating during fieldwork or travel.
